Post by: Miyuki on August 28, 2014, 10:16:03 AM
Did you ask about puberty blockers (GnRH agonists)? I know that in many areas doctors will not prescribe hormone therapy to people under 18, but they should at least allow you to take something to halt puberty so that testosterone doesn't have a chance to do any damage while you wait until you can start estrogen. I know it's not exactly ideal, but it should make sure you at least have a very good starting place when you are finally able to start taking estrogen.
